Output e076cc316af7571b1dc1c25c901b4a528fbee902dcaa0ae3dcdba5f755dd95a4:2

value
1823896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206c639ae5aed23ee9b519b20ba2dc6e837cd3fa OP_EQUAL
address
34eTPgqzD1Re55Au9gpePgncANZugKnvbT
transaction
e076cc316af7571b1dc1c25c901b4a528fbee902dcaa0ae3dcdba5f755dd95a4
spent
true